This week on the #Peston Podcast we’re discussing:

❶ What kind of impact will Dominic Cummings’s renewed criticism have on the popularity and credibility of the government?
❷ How much are politicians in the UK exploiting ‘culture wars’?
❸ Will we get back to something that looks like 'normal' on July 19th?

All this and more as we join ITV’s Political Editor Robert Peston with Former No.10 Race Adviser Samuel Kasumu, Business Secretary Kwasi Kwarteng MP, Musician Professor Green, Labour’s Dawn Butler MP and former Health Secretary and Chair of the Health Select Committee Jeremy Hunt.
